Ham and Swiss Quiche

Ham and Swiss Quiche

A delicious quiche recipe with a hint of lemon flavor.

Course Breakfast, Brunch
Cuisine American
Keyword Breakfast, Brunch, ham, Quiche, Swiss
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 45 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 5 minutes
Servings 6
Author Sweeter With Sugar

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 cups ham diced
  • 6 ounces Swiss Cheese grated
  • 1/4 cup green onion sliced
  • 4 eggs beaten
  • 1 1/4 cups half and half
  • 2 tbsp flour
  • 1/4 tsp mace
  • 1/4 tsp dry mustard
  • 1/2 tsp lemon peel zest
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/8 tsp pepper
  • pie crust homemade or pre-made, like Pillsbury pie crust dough

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°

  2. Press pie crust into a pie pan. Set aside.

  3. Whisk eggs.

  4. Add half and half, flour, mace, dry mustard, lemon zest, salt and pepper. Mix to combine.

  5. Layer ham, swiss cheese, and green onion in the bottom of the pie crust.

  6. Pour egg mixture into pie crust over the ham, swiss cheese, and onion.

  7. Place in pre-heated oven. Bake at 400° for 15 minutes.

  8. Then, without removing quiche, turn oven down to 325° and continue cooking for 30 minutes.

  9. Remove from oven and allow to cool for a few minutes.

  10. Serve and enjoy!
